Ingredients for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e
To create the delicious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ole, you’ll need a variety of fresh and flavorful ingredients. Each component plays a vital role in bringing this dish to life.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 3 cups cooked rotisserie chicken, shredded
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1 cup spinach, chopped
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 teaspoons Italian seasoning
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 cup penne pasta, uncooked
These ingredients combine to create a rich and satisfying dish. The rotisserie chicken saves time and adds flavor, while the cherry tomatoes and spinach provide a burst of freshness. The heavy cream and cheeses create a creamy texture that binds everything together. Italian seasoning, garlic powder, and onion powder enhance the overall taste, making each bite a delightful experience.

Step-by-Step Preparation of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, it’s time to dive into the step-by-step preparation of the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e. This process is straightforward and enjoyable, allowing you to create a delicious meal with ease. Let’s get started!
Step 1: Prepping the Chicken
First, take your cooked rotisserie chicken and shred it into bite-sized pieces. You can use your hands or two forks for this task. Shredding the chicken helps it mix well with the other ingredients. If you prefer, you can also use leftover chicken from a previous meal. This step is quick and ensures that your casserole is packed with flavor.
Step 2: Preparing the Vegetables
Next, it’s time to prepare the vegetables. Start by washing the cherry tomatoes and cutting them in half. This allows their juices to blend beautifully with the other ingredients. Then, chop the spinach into smaller pieces. This will help it wilt nicely when cooked.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the halved cherry tomatoes and sauté them for about 3-4 minutes until they start to soften. After that, stir in the chopped spinach and cook for an additional 2 minutes until it wilts. This step enhances the flavors and adds a lovely freshness to your casserole.
Step 3: Mixing the Sauce
In a large mixing bowl, combine the shredded chicken, sautéed vegetables, heavy cream, mozzarella cheese, and grated Parmesan cheese. Then, sprinkle in the Italian seasoning,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ix everything together until well combined. This creamy mixture is the heart of your casserole, bringing all the flavors together in a delightful way. Make sure every piece of chicken and vegetable is coated in the sauce for maximum flavor!
Step 4: Assembling the Casserole
Now, it’s time to assemble your casserole. Take a 9×13 inch baking dish and spread the uncooked penne pasta evenly across the bottom. This pasta will cook perfectly in the oven, soaking up all the delicious flavors. Pour the chicken and vegetable mixture over the pasta, spreading it evenly. Make sure to cover the pasta completely with the mixture. This ensures that every bite is flavorful and satisfying.
Step 5: Baking the Casserole
Finally, cover the baking dish with aluminum foil and place it in the preheated oven at 375°F. Bake for 25 minutes. After that, carefully remove the foil and bake for an additional 15-20 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when the cheese is bubbly and golden brown. Once done, let the casserole cool for about 5 minutes before serving. This cooling time allows the flavors to settle, making each bite even more enjoyable!

Gluten-Free Alternatives
For those who need a gluten-free option, you can easily modify the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e. Here are some tips:
- Gluten-Free Pasta: Substitute the penne pasta with gluten-free pasta. There are many varieties available, such as rice or quinoa pasta.
- Check Labels: Ensure that all your ingredients, including sauces and seasonings, are gluten-free. Some brands may contain hidden gluten.
- Quinoa: For a unique twist, consider using cooked quinoa instead of pasta. It’s gluten-free and adds a nutty flavor.

Tips for Perfecting Your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e
To ensure your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ole turns out perfectly every time, consider these helpful tips. They will enhance the flavors and textures, making your dish even more delightful. Let’s dive into some expert advice!
First, always taste your mixture before baking. This step allows you to adjust the seasoning to your liking. If you prefer a bit more flavor, feel free to add extra garlic powder or Italian seasoning. A pinch of salt can also elevate the overall taste.
Next, don’t skip the sautéing step for the vegetables. Cooking the cherry tomatoes and spinach beforehand helps to release their flavors and moisture. This prevents the casserole from becoming too watery during baking. Plus, it adds a lovely depth to the dish.
When it comes to cheese, consider using a mix of cheeses for added flavor. While mozzarella and Parmesan are fantastic, adding a bit of provolone or fontina can create a richer taste. Just remember to adjust the quantities to maintain the creamy texture.
Another tip is to let the casserole rest after baking. Allowing it to cool for about 5-10 minutes before serving helps the layers set. This makes it easier to cut and serve, ensuring that each portion holds its shape beautifully.
Lastly, don’t hesitate to get creative with toppings. A sprinkle of fresh herbs like basil or parsley right before serving can add a burst of freshness. You can also add a drizzle of balsamic glaze for a sweet and tangy finish that complements the dish perfectly.

FAQs about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ole Recipe
Can I make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ole ahead of time. Simply follow all the steps up to the baking point, then cover the dish and refrigerate it. When you’re ready to bake, just pop it in the oven. You may need to add a few extra minutes to the cooking time since it will be cold from the fridge. This makes it a great option for meal prep or for hosting gatherings!
What can I substitute for chicken in this recipe?
If you’re looking for a substitute for chicken, there are several delicious options. For a vegetarian version, consider using chickpeas, tofu, or even mushrooms. These ingredients provide a hearty texture and absorb the flavors of the dish well. If you prefer a different protein, shredded turkey or cooked sausage can also work nicely. Feel free to get creative and choose what suits your taste!
How do I store leftovers of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ole?
Storing leftovers is easy! Allow the casserole to cool completely, then transfer it to an airtight container. You can keep it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ply reheat individual portions in the microwave or warm it in the oven until heated through. This makes for a quick and satisfying meal on busy days!
Can I freeze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ole?
Yes, you can freeze the Baked Tuscan Chicken Casserole! To do this, prepare the casserole as directed but do not bake it. Instead, cover it tightly with plastic wrap and then a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n. It can be stored in the freezer for up to 2-3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and then bake as instructed. This is a fantastic way to have a homemade meal ready at a moment’s notice!
